We often hear a lot about how artificial intelligence (AI) might change our jobs, and sometimes that can sound a bit scary. But a recent report highlights a different side of the story: AI is actually creating brand new types of jobs, opening up new career paths that didn't exist just a few years ago.

Think about it this way: when computers first came out, people worried about job losses. But then we saw the rise of software developers, IT support, and web designers — all roles that were unheard of before. AI is doing something similar. It's not just automating old tasks; it's demanding new skills and roles to build, manage, and integrate these smart systems into businesses. For example, a company called Box, which provides cloud storage, has seen 13 new job categories emerge thanks to AI.

These new roles often involve understanding both the technology and how it can solve real-world problems. They might be about 'prompt engineering' – learning how to ask an AI the right questions to get the best results – or roles like 'AI ethicists', who make sure AI is used fairly and responsibly. There's also a growing need for specialists who can help businesses integrate AI tools seamlessly into their existing operations, making sure everything runs smoothly without disrupting daily work.

Why it matters

This matters because it shifts the conversation from just job losses to job creation, offering a more balanced view of AI's impact on our workforce. For small business owners, it highlights where future talent might come from and how AI can bring new skills into their operations, ultimately making them more efficient and competitive.
